How much should I charge to hem pants?

Hemming Pants, Skirts, or Dresses: $10 to $25 – Skirts with a lining cost more to hem than unlined ones. Shortening Sleeves: $15 to $40 – Jacket sleeves cost more than shirt sleeves, and jackets with buttons and linings cost more than plain ones.

Can jeans be hemmed?

Shorten Long Jeans With Hemming Good news: Shortening too-long jeans (aka hemming jeans) is the easiest alteration you can make to denim pants. A tailor or seamstress can shorten them, either by cutting off some fabric and redoing the hems or taking up the hems in a way that doesn’t involve cutting the fabric.

Can I get jeans taken in?

It’s possible to have the waist taken in by a tailor, but this is more of a delicate procedure. Because jeans aren’t built with easily-altered seats and waists, there’s more room for error and even less room to let out. A good tailor will take in the waist at the back, directly in the center.

How long does it take to hem pants?

Depending on the type of material and the style you plan to adopt in hemming your jeans, the tasks shouldn’t run for more than a few minutes to a couple of hours. For professional sewers, jeans hem can be done in as little time as 10 minutes.

What does it mean to get your jeans hemmed?

Hem: The edge of a piece of fabric that is (or needs to be) sewn to prevent it from unraveling. Most suit trousers are sold unhemmed with the intent of you taking them to a tailor to give them a custom fit.

There are additional charges for sewing pants with linings, cuffs, and vents. For example, Ali’s Fashion in Scottsdale, Arizona charges $20 to hem plain trousers, $25 for those cuffed or lined, and $25 for jeans. If the pants are made of leather, expect to pay between $30 and $40 for hemming.

How much does it cost to hem leather pants?

If the pants are made of leather, expect to pay between $30 and $40 for hemming. Adding a hem guard will also cost you extra bucks. Look for alteration shops in your area.

How much does it cost to repair a hem on a dress?

When a stitch starts to unravel then you are looking at paying between $10 and $14 to get the hem repaired. The price may be higher if you take it to a very classy dressmaking shop to get the work done. You should shop around to make sure you get the right price for you.

What is the best way to hem jeans?

The easiest and quickest method for hemming jeans is to use a standard sewing machine. The process takes around 30 minutes, and if you use the right stitch, your jeans will withstand wear and tear for many washes. It’s very important to use the appropriate needle.
